What to Expect on Your 4×4 Desert Adventure
Starting a 4×4 adventure in the stunning Wahiba Sands needs some prep and knowing what’s ahead. This vast desert is a short two-hour drive from Muscat, Oman’s capital. Get ready for a mix of excitement and peaceful desert views on your Wahiba Sands journey.
Driving through the dunes, you’ll face steep climbs and thrilling descents. Lower your tire pressure to half or two-thirds of the usual before hitting the sand. This tweak helps you grip the sand better and ride smoother over the vast desert.
During your desert adventure, you’ll find many fun activities. Try dune bashing, quad biking, sandboarding, camel riding, and sunset drives. The soft sand makes every turn a new discovery, full of amazing views and surprises.
Also, you’ll get to see Oman’s natural wonders. Look out for local wildlife and enjoy stunning sunsets. Camping is allowed, but stay safe—travel with a group and keep an eye out.
The best time to visit is from November to February, when it’s cooler. Watch out for sandstorms, which can last a couple of hours. They might affect some camp activities, like pool use. Essential Preparation for Off-Road Driving Wahiba Sands
Driving off-road in Wahiba Sands needs careful planning. Start by picking a 4×4 vehicle that can handle soft sand and steep hills. This ensures a safe trip through this beautiful area.
Choosing the Right 4×4 Vehicle
A 4WD vehicle is best for off-road driving in Wahiba Sands. They have the power and grip to move through sandy areas and different conditions. Knowing your 4×4’s features, like locking differentials and low-range gearing, helps you face tough terrains.
Importance of Vehicle Maintenance
Regular vehicle checks are key before your trip. Make sure tires, brakes, and the engine are in good shape. A well-kept vehicle is less likely to break down, letting you enjoy your drive without worries. Reading your vehicle’s manual can help you use its off-road features effectively.
Safety Gear and Supplies
Having the right safety gear is crucial. Make sure to pack:
- A shovel for digging out sand
- Sand ladders to help get out of tough spots
- Tire-pressure gauges for the right tire pressure
Lowering tire pressure helps with traction on soft sand. This makes your drive safer and more fun through Wahiba Sands.
Driving Techniques for Desert Conditions
Driving off-road in deserts, like Wahiba Sands, requires special skills. Learning these techniques will improve your experience and safety. Knowing how to handle the terrain, whether it’s tall dunes or tricky paths, is key.
Maintaining Momentum on Dunes
Keeping speed up when climbing dunes is crucial. Going too slow can get you stuck. Start with a steady pace, letting your vehicle push through the sand.
Adjust your throttle and gear to keep the wheels moving. This helps you climb the dunes smoothly.
Understanding Dune Angles and Approaches
Choosing the right angle when approaching dunes is important. Instead of going straight up, try a slight angle. This spreads your weight better and lowers the chance of tipping.
Knowing the heights of dunes, some up to 100 meters, helps you navigate. It makes tackling Wahiba Sands’ dunes easier.
Recognizing Risks and Avoiding Stuck Situations
Being aware of risks in the desert is essential. Sudden drops and hidden obstacles can be tricky. Learning to spot these dangers helps you avoid getting stuck.
If unsure about a path, it’s best to go back and rethink your route. Tips from Wahiba Sands can guide you in making smart choices.

Wildlife and Flora in Wahiba Sands
The desert is home to many species, like the Arabian oryx and sand fox. These creatures are adapted to the desert’s harsh climate.
Unique plants, like ghaf trees and desert violets, add to the landscape. They show nature’s strength. Exploring these elements adds to your desert adventure, connecting you with the wildlife and plants.
Guided Tours vs. Independent Off-Road Driving
Exploring the magical Wahiba Sands comes down to two choices: guided tours or driving on your own. Each option has its own benefits, depending on what you prefer and your driving skills.
Guided tours offer the comfort of having experienced drivers. They know the area well and can teach you about the landscape, culture, and ecosystems. With a guide, you can relax and enjoy the views without worrying about getting lost or facing challenges.
Driving on your own, though, gives you freedom and adventure. You can go at your own pace and find secret spots not seen on tours. This way, you can really connect with nature and change your plans as you like. But, you need to know your 4×4 well and be ready for different terrains.
